Preventive Dentistry
Proactive solutions that ensure lifelong dental health
Routine dental care—including annual exams and regular cleanings—helps detect problems early and address them with protective treatments such as fluoride and sealants. When you have your teeth examined and cleaned on a regular basis, you save money by not needing extensive restorative work.

Invisalign®
A state-of-the-art alternative to traditional braces
Using custom aligners made of virtually invisible plastic, Invisalign® gradually straightens your teeth, making it ideal for patients of all ages. Invisalign® addresses both cosmetic concerns and underlying issues such as overbites.

Dental Emergencies
Some problems require urgent attention outside of normal office hours. If you have any of the following issues, please call 954-514-3117 immediately:
- Your tooth has been fractured or knocked out entirely
- You have an oral infection, including swelling that makes it difficult to breathe
- You have severe, persistent dental pain that doesn’t go away with over-the-counter pain medication
If you’ve lost a crown or a filling, please call us to set up an appointment as soon as possible.
